Transaction 9611089c7f6c6da2284702e4d0030c63f1658162b30744be700b2c1076116cad
1 Input
1 Output
-
9611089c7f6c6da2284702e4d0030c63f1658162b30744be700b2c1076116cad:0
- value
- 12082464829
- script pubkey
- OP_0 OP_PUSHBYTES_32 3b6061f018b4c171525adcbffd5efb36ba8ce1129e30bf33a45c9c91a6b2b66d
- address
- bc1q8dsxruqcknqhz5j6mjll6hhmx6agecgjncct7vaytjwfrf4jkeksqey9lv